Abstract

557,121. R÷ntgen-ray apparatus. WATSON, W., and ILFORD, Ltd. Aug. 5, 1942, No. 10919. [Class 98 (i)] The Potter-Bucky or like grid used in radiography is connected with one or more spring members so that it may be oscillated in the plane of the grid bars and in a direction inclined to them by flexing and releasing the members, the oscillations thus produced dying away and so avoiding the formation of shadow patterns of the grid at the ends of its movement which occurs when the oscillations are of constant amplitude. In the form shown a rectangular grid 14 is carried by a frame 13 supported by leaf springs 11 from a base 10 which carries the film cassette. The springs are flexed and released mechanically or manually, for example by a cord secured to one of them, and oscillate the frame 13 in a diagonal direction. The grid may be inserted in the frame in two angularly related, as shown mutually perpendicular, positions. In another form, the grid is carried by a turntable mounted in the frame, and in order that the direction of oscillation may be maintained transverse to that of the grid bars, however the grid is oriented, the leaf springs 11 are connected to the frame by ball joints and are secured at their lower ends to spindles mounted on the base 10. The spindles are simultaneously rotatably adjusted by sprockets engaged by a common sprocket chain, thus maintaining the flat surfaces of the springs in parallel planes. Fig. 4 shows electrical means for giving intermittent impulses to the springs during a long exposure, comprising a solenoid 34 the energizing circuit of which is controlled by contacts of which one is mounted on the spring 11 which it operates, and by a valve 39 which becomes intermittently conductive at periods determined by the build-up of potential in a condenser resistance circuit 43, 40. The grid may comprise two superposed and mutually inclined sets of grid bars. Two superposed grids having their sets of grid bars mutually inclined may be independently oscillated in opposite directions ; they may be arranged in a vertical plane and oscillated in a substantially horizontal direction in this plane.
